Daijiworld Media Network - Udupi (HB)
Udupi, Nov 1: The district administration organized the 66th Kannada Rajyotsava awards ceremony on an impressive scale at Mahatma Gandhi Stadium, Ajjarkad here on Monday, November 1.
Kannada and Culture minister, Sunil Kumar, said that Kannada shapes one's behaviour and personality.
Kannadigas should get more employment opportunities in their home state. Kannadigas should get priority first. The state government is working towards that goal. Kannada is losing its existence and other languages are becoming indispensable in IT and BT companies, he regretted.
Udupi district is in the forefront as far as promoting Kannada and Tulu languages and folk culture. Kannadigas are concerned. People form here are living in Mumbai, Dubai and across the world, he added.
"There are no uniform norms for selecting achievers, and there is no restriction on the number to choose. But next year onward, the government will frame uniform rules in relation to the selection of achievers," he said.
'I wish today's young generation to emerge as young writers. Let us inculcate the reading habit in the children," he stressed.
The students performed to patriotic songs, after a gap of two years and actively participated in cultural programmes.
District Rajyotsava awards were conferred to 35 achievers of various sectors.
